John and Anne Phillips, lawyer and doctor respectively, arrived in Nigeria in 1954 where his brother and sister were already serving as CMA missionaries. John became a tutor at the Dennis Memorial Grammar School (DMGS)at Onitsha and later became principal of the James Welch Grammar School, Emevor. Anne practised as a doctor. They later served in Sierra Leone and Liverpool before returning to the Diocese of the Niger where John became principal of the DMGS and the Religious Education Advisor to the Diocese.
The papers were given to the HMC by Anne Phillips and consist of letters, pamphlets and photographs relating to missionary, education, medical work in West Africa in general and Nigeria in particular and include many papers relating to the history and administration of the Anglican Diocese of the Niger. They are dated from1896 to 2004.
